Before diving into the selection and installation process, it's essential to grasp the basics of 3D wall panels. These panels are typically made from a variety of materials, including plastic, PVC, gypsum, or wood, and are designed to create visual depth and dimension on flat surfaces. The panels feature intricate patterns, geometric designs, or organic textures that catch the light and cast captivating shadows, adding a dynamic element to any room.

Before installing 3D wall panels, ensure that your walls are clean, dry, and free from any imperfections. Remove any existing wallpaper or paint and fill in any cracks or holes with spackling compound. Once the surface is smooth and even, you're ready to proceed with installation.

Once your 3D wall panels are installed, proper maintenance is essential to preserve their appearance and longevity. Regular dusting or vacuuming with a soft brush attachment will help keep the panels free from dirt and debris. Avoid using harsh chemicals or abrasive cleaners, as they may damage the surface or finish of the panels.
